// Code generated by mockery. DO NOT EDIT.
package mock_syncinterfaces
import (
context "context"
pgx "github.com/jackc/pgx/v4"
mock "github.com/stretchr/testify/mock"
)
// StateBeginTransactionInterface is an autogenerated mock type for the StateBeginTransactionInterface type
type StateBeginTransactionInterface struct {
mock.Mock
}
type StateBeginTransactionInterface_Expecter struct {
mock *mock.Mock
}
func (_m *StateBeginTransactionInterface) EXPECT() *StateBeginTransactionInterface_Expecter {
return &StateBeginTransactionInterface_Expecter{mock: &_m.Mock}
}
// BeginStateTransaction provides a mock function with given fields: ctx
func (_m *StateBeginTransactionInterface) BeginStateTransaction(ctx context.Context) (pgx.Tx, error) {
ret := _m.Called(ctx)
if len(ret) == 0 {
panic("no return value specified for BeginStateTransaction")
}
var r0 pgx.Tx
var r1 error
if rf, ok := ret.Get(0).(func(context.Context) (pgx.Tx, error)); ok {
return rf(ctx)
}
if rf, ok := ret.Get(0).(func(context.Context) pgx.Tx); ok {
r0 = rf(ctx)
} else {
if ret.Get(0) != nil {
r0 = ret.Get(0).(pgx.Tx)
}
}
if rf, ok := ret.Get(1).(func(context.Context) error); ok {
r1 = rf(ctx)
} else {
r1 = ret.Error(1)
}
return r0, r1
}
// StateBeginTransactionInterface_BeginStateTransaction_Call is a *mock.Call that shadows Run/Return methods with type explicit version for method 'BeginStateTransaction'
type StateBeginTransactionInterface_BeginStateTransaction_Call struct {
*mock.Call
}
// BeginStateTransaction is a helper method to define mock.On call
// - ctx context.Context
func (_e *StateBeginTransactionInterface_Expecter) BeginStateTransaction(ctx interface{}) *StateBeginTransactionInterface_BeginStateTransaction_Call {
return &StateBeginTransactionInterface_BeginStateTransaction_Call{Call: _e.mock.On("BeginStateTransaction", ctx)}
}
func (_c *StateBeginTransactionInterface_BeginStateTransaction_Call) Run(run func(ctx context.Context)) *StateBeginTransactionInterface_BeginStateTransaction_Call {
_c.Call.Run(func(args mock.Arguments) {
run(args[0].(context.Context))
})
return _c
}
func (_c *StateBeginTransactionInterface_BeginStateTransaction_Call) Return(_a0 pgx.Tx, _a1 error) *StateBeginTransactionInterface_BeginStateTransaction_Call {
_c.Call.Return(_a0, _a1)
return _c
}
func (_c *StateBeginTransactionInterface_BeginStateTransaction_Call) RunAndReturn(run func(context.Context) (pgx.Tx, error)) *StateBeginTransactionInterface_BeginStateTransaction_Call {
_c.Call.Return(run)
return _c
}
// NewStateBeginTransactionInterface creates a new instance of StateBeginTransactionInterface. It also registers a testing interface on the mock and a cleanup function to assert the mocks expectations.
// The first argument is typically a *testing.T value.
func NewStateBeginTransactionInterface(t interface {
mock.TestingT
Cleanup(func())
}) *StateBeginTransactionInterface {
mock := &StateBeginTransactionInterface{}
mock.Mock.Test(t)
t.Cleanup(func() { mock.AssertExpectations(t) })
return mock
}
